Question 441789: Martin needs to mix some 40% alcohol solution with some 90% alcohol solution to obtain 15 liters of an 80% solution. How much of the 40% solution and how much of the 90% solution should he use?

Question 441783: One type of lawn fertilizer consists of a mixture of Nitrogen, N, Phosphorus, P, and Potassium, K. An 80 Pound sample contains 8 more pounds of nitrogen and phosphorus than potassium. There is 9 times as much potassium as phosphorus.
A. write a system of three equations whose solution gives the amount of n, p, and k in this sample.
B. slove the system

Question 442341: Two solutions of salt water contain 0.05% and 0.15% salt respectively. A lab technician wants to make 1 liter of solution which contains 0.07% salt. How much of each solution should she use?

Question 442805: A chemist needs 9 liters of a 50% salt solution. All she has available is a 20% salt solution and a 70% salt solution. How much of each of the two solutions should she mix to obtain her desired solution? Show work please.
